the baddest harley davidson road racer with a sportster based motor and one of the most underrated riders ever in the sport of road racing. Gene church the rider and don tilley the tuner made history many times over on this bike. go to dave gess web site and see or go to tale section and look at the lucifers hammer thread. |

From the first page of the archive of Classic Buells and Buell History ... this is Gene with LH2. As I understand it, LH2 was the 2nd RR1000, the first being the read/white/blue prototype now owned by John Mikosh. The 3rd one carried VIN 1, it's owned by Devin Battley of Battley Cycles in Gaithersburg, MD. Pictures of all these bikes, as well as the RW750's that preceded them, can be found on that page. |
